#beb436 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#beb436 is composed of 74.5% red, 70.6%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.3% magenta, 71.6%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 55.6 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 47.8%. #beb436 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#7d6900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#beb436

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070602 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#beb436

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7c78 is the less saturated color, while #eddc07 is the most saturated one.
